Understanding the Role of Air Ducts in Your HVAC System
Your air ducts are essentially the lungs of your home. They distribute heated or cooled air from your HVAC system to each room, and they return stale air back to the core units for filtration and reconditioning. Whether you have a furnace, central air conditioner, or a heat pump, the system relies on the integrity of these ducts to function efficiently. Condensation forms in air ducts when moist, warm air meets the cooler surfaces inside the ductwork—especially if that ductwork isn’t insulated responsibly or lives in spaces like attics or crawl spaces where temperature differentials are more extreme.
What Causes Condensation in Air Ducts?
Condensation usually stems from a collision between cold ductwork and warm, humid air. It’s physics, and unfortunately, it’s persistent. If your home experiences high humidity—maybe due to seasonal weather, insufficient ventilation in bathrooms or kitchens, or foundation leaks—you’re giving condensation plenty of raw material to work with. The air ducts, especially if they run through unconditioned spaces, offer cooler surfaces where moisture from the air condenses into droplets. That collected moisture doesn’t just disappear; it often soaks into insulation, drips onto drywall, or invites biological contaminants you don’t want to deal with later—like mold or mildew.
The Consequences of Ignoring the Problem
Ignoring condensation in your air ducts can lead to expensive and even hazardous consequences. Mold growth, for instance, is a frequent side effect and can impair indoor air quality and trigger respiratory issues for you and your family. Over time, water droplets collecting inside ductwork can weaken duct joints, erode insulation, and cause long-term inefficiencies in your HVAC system’s performance. Eventually, water damage expands to surrounding structures—wood rot in framing, warped drywall, staining, and even ceiling collapses. Homeowners often miss the issue until it leaves a more visible mark—by the time there’s a water stain, the underlying problem has likely been brewing for a while.
How to Prevent Condensation from Forming
Tackling duct condensation is more about prevention than repair. First, proper duct insulation is critical. If your ducts pass through unconditioned areas like the attic or basement, that’s where condensation commonly starts. Upgrading the insulation around the duct exterior can dramatically reduce the surface temperature differential that causes moisture to condense in the first place. In tandem with insulation, controlling your home’s humidity levels is essential. Dehumidifiers, exhaust fans, and smart home thermostats that monitor relative humidity can keep your home’s environment consistent and reduce overall moisture content. And don’t neglect system maintenance—replacing clogged air filters, checking for duct leaks, and ensuring that air returns are unblocked will help your HVAC system breathe more easily, which keeps everything running more efficiently and reduces moisture accumulation.
When It’s Time to Call a Professional
There’s only so much a homeowner can address on their own. If condensation issues persist after adjusting humidity levels and insulating ducts, it’s time to bring in HVAC professionals. They’ll assess whether your system is oversized, improperly balanced, or compromised by leaks or faulty return air flow. Sometimes, the root of the issue is less about moisture and more about air pressure and temperature imbalance. Additionally, professional duct cleaning and inspection might reveal microbial buildup or structural flaws that need more aggressive mitigation.
